Here is my issue with that. You put the power in the hand of the person who is... most likely, already being careless or, in some cases, malicious.
I'd rather offer a "Forgive" option, as Macc suggested and I mentioned earlier as well. You have the power to forgive, but not punish. 3 unforgiven TKs is a kick no matter what.
Here is how I see the Vote to Kick being abused. Player A is you, just trying to play the objective and enjoy the game. Player B is a troll, or someone who just takes offense to you or can't get over being TK'd the first time by you, which was purely accidental. Player B then continually seeks out Player A, gets TK'd 2 times more and now has the power to kick that player.
Sure, any system can be abused, but I'd rather not see punishment power put in the hands of players on any level, rather see the ability to forgive.
